Pakistan has received unprecedented rains this monsoon season, creating a massive humanitarian crisis in the province of Khyber Pakhtunkhwa (KP). Overflowing rivers and flash floods have damaged or destroyed hundreds of homes, along with dozens of schools and health facilities.

Save the Children has been working in Pakistan since 1979 and our response team is mobilizing to help meet the most urgent needs of children and their families. Our response efforts include:

- Setting up child friendly spaces and providing psychosocial support to help children affected by the floods feel safe
- Assisting with the rehabilitation of damaged schools and deploying Temporary Learning Spaces (TLS) to help children return to learning
- Distributing dignity and hygiene kits to support children's health, hygiene, and safety needs
